What model is the gun?

A Go/No Go gauge would be necessary for the main test of safety. I doubt many gunsmiths would have one for .25 ACP in their arsenal of gauges, but I could be wrong.

As others have said, Firearms Service Center and Kygunco would both be great choices as they have older gunsmiths there that would be more likely to have the tools to properly test the chamber. Personally, as long as the gun goes into battery and neccessary parts are there, I'd feel comfortable shooting it. Unless it's a Colt 1908, Tomcat or Jetfire you'll be spending almost as much money having it looked over than it's worth. Jennings and Phoenix arms are junk.
